Output 3f8ddf0dcdc89b9068c92e5e17e75db3057b37dcf6bdbec7c8058085d1bc1d26:55

value
40753184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81fce67ae7534af5d823a43bf2fce9e99fb9727 OP_EQUAL
address
3H1yYi7QCcq2yj28MN9xKegWq3HmevRJXR
transaction
3f8ddf0dcdc89b9068c92e5e17e75db3057b37dcf6bdbec7c8058085d1bc1d26
spent
true